A Naval Bandmaster Imprisoned and Disgraced.
(Per Press Association.) Sydney, August 17. A court martial has found Chief Bandmaster Wright, of H.M.S. Tauranga, guilty of misappropriating moneys and desertion. He has been sentenced to two years' imprisonment and dismissed from the service with disgrace-
